about

‘Nothing prepares you for the standout track, “Jerusalem”, which provides the missing evolutionary link between Barry McGuire’s “Eve Of Destruction” and Nick Cave in best biblical mode.’

- Uncut Magazine

'A black-magical Devendra Banhart in a different time/place long before this freakfolk thing hit, the English bard Simon Finn released Pass The Distance, a sprawling, fractured, dense brew of dark acid-folk... The album’s centerpiece is “Jerusalem”, a six-minute, shiver-inducing crucifixion-of-Jesus exorcism that anticipates Current 93 as well as a bevy of lesser apocalyptic folkies. By its ecstatic, organ smashed final strains, you can’t but help imagining Finn sweaty and in a trance,
his guitar splintered and speaking different six-string languages.”

- Pitchfork

credits

released April 1, 1970

Artwork – David Toop
Drums, Tabla, Percussion, Dulcimer – Paul Burwell
Lead Guitar, Steel Guitar, Mandolin, Electric Bass, Flute, Piano, Harmonium, Accordion, Violin, Percussion – David Toop
Organ – Kenny Elliott* (tracks: A4, A5)
Photography By – Marie Yates
Producer, Engineer – Vic Keary
Recorder – Rob Bucklin (tracks: B4)
Vocals, Guitar, Percussion – Simon Finn
Written-By – Simon Finn
